A propshaft, also known as a driveshaft, is a crucial component of a vehicle's drivetrain system. It serves the purpose of transmitting power from the engine to the wheels, allowing the wheels to rotate and move the car forward. Propshafts consist of several interconnected parts, including universal joints, slip yokes, center bearings, and couplings.
Maintaining your propshafts and their associated parts is vital for the optimal performance and safety of your car. Over time, these components can wear out, leading to vibration, excessive noise, and even failure. Neglecting repairs or replacement can result in further damage to other parts of your vehicle's drivetrain, increasing the overall repair costs.
If you notice any unusual noises, excessive vibrations, or loss of power when accelerating, it could indicate a problem with your propshaft. Promptly addressing these issues can help prevent further damage and maintain the proper functioning of your vehicle.
While replacing faulty propshafts and parts is essential, upgrading them can offer additional benefits. Upgraded propshafts, made from higher-quality materials or with enhanced designs, can provide improved strength, durability, and performance. This can be particularly advantageous for those who frequently engage in off-road driving, high-speed racing, or towing heavy loads.
When considering an upgrade, it's advisable to consult with a qualified mechanic or specialist who can recommend suitable options based on your specific vehicle and usage requirements.
Ignoring propshaft issues or leaving them unattended can lead to severe consequences. A damaged or faulty propshaft can not only affect your car's drivability but also compromise other vital components such as the differential or transmission. Continuing to operate a vehicle with a damaged propshaft can result in complete drivetrain failure, leaving you stranded and facing costly repairs.
Regularly inspecting and maintaining propshafts and their associated parts can save you from unexpected breakdowns and the inconvenience of being stranded on the side of the road.
Diagnosing a faulty propshaft typically involves a visual inspection and listening for any unusual noises during operation. Excessive play, signs of wear, or visible damage could indicate the need for repair or replacement. Additionally, a mechanic may use specialized equipment to measure propshaft balance and alignment, ensuring optimal performance.
Aside from the propshaft itself, other components like universal joints, slip yokes, center bearings, and couplings may also contribute to drivetrain issues. Careful inspection of these parts along with the propshaft can help pinpoint the source of the problem for effective repairs.
